Output 5aab64eaf59a0b40f22296183f00d50ef4353d49a63d77a8740c07e2279cf636:0

value
17219044
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7fd54eee52ffce060cd4a99c0563283382ae0174 OP_EQUALVERIFY OP_CHECKSIG
address
1CevMHWYoN1VTrCAN6EBew2FXh15mg3iwn
transaction
5aab64eaf59a0b40f22296183f00d50ef4353d49a63d77a8740c07e2279cf636
spent
true